3.4
Installation in Windows XP 64-bit Edition
Administrator rights are required to install the
FRITZ!WLAN USB Stick N in Windows XP 64-bit Edition!
1.
Switch on the WLAN device you wish to connect to.
2.
Switch on your computer.
3.
Insert the FRITZ!WLAN USB Stick N into the USB port
on your computer.
Windows detects the FRITZ!WLAN USB Stick N auto-
matically. This process may take some time.
4.
When asked whether you would like to connect to
Windows Update, select the option “No, not this
time” and then click “Next”.
The “Add New Hardware Wizard” starts and searches
for drivers.
5.
Insert the FRITZ!WLAN USB Stick N CD and select the
option “Install software automatically (recommend-
ed)”. Confirm with “Continue”.
If an additional Windows dialog asks if you want to
install software not digitally signed by Microsoft,
click the “Continue Anyway” button. This request de-
pends on the driver signature options set on your
computer.
